Six more illegal immigrants were arrested Friday by Bay County Sheriff’s deputies and Parker Police.

Lawmen were responding to complaints about possible illegals working at a road construction site in the area of Wallace Road and East Highway 98.

Six of the workers had been hired after apparently giving the contractor, Anderson Columbia, fraudulent social security numbers during the application process.

The company cooperated with lawmen during the investigation. All six were charged with criminal use of personal identification information.
